After a hiatus of 40+ years, Leslie Green rekindled her great passion for weaving in her

home studio in beautiful Brown County Indiana. Here, she keeps three floor looms busy

creating unique handwoven pieces of personal attire and houseware.

Rather than having a standard line of repeatable products, Leslie prefers to continually

explore a variety of new weaving structures of intricate designs and rich colors. Using

natural fibers, her goal is to create distinctive pieces of beauty and elegance.

In her Indiana Bird Song creations, Leslie dresses her loom to incorporate the recorded

sound patterns of a particular bird song with the distinct colors and patterns of its

plumage. To date, she has featured the Kestrel, Northern Flicker, Eastern Bluebird, and

Cerulean Warbler in this series.
